How Much Does a Psychiatric Assessment Cost?
A general psychiatric assessment assessment is a crucial action in getting treatment for a psychological health condition. Nevertheless, it can be a pricey process.
Thankfully, most insurance strategies cover a part of the costs connected with these gos to. To lower your expenses, you must constantly be sure that your company is in-network.
Expenses for a Psychiatric Evaluation
A psychiatric assessment is a crucial step in determining if an individual has a mental disorder or needs treatment for a psychological health condition. A psychiatric examination is generally completed by a psychiatrist, who is a medical physician who has gone through additional training in the field of psychiatry to end up being a professional in treating behavioral signs of mental disorders. During a psychiatric assessment, the psychiatrist will analyze the patient's history and signs. They will ask concerns about the patient's family history, their present medications and any previous psychiatric treatments they have actually gone through. The psychiatric evaluation will likewise include an interview and standardized composed questionnaires. In some cases, the psychiatric evaluation might need imaging or blood tests.
Numerous elements can influence just how much a psychiatric assessment expenses. For example, the place of a psychiatrist's workplace can affect prices as some psychiatrists are located in significant cities where rent and living expenses are greater than other areas. Moreover, the experience of a psychiatrist can contribute in just how to get a psychiatric assessment much they charge for their services. Those who have more years of experience in the field might charge more than those who have less time on the task.
Another factor that influences a psychiatric examination's cost is the type of insurance protection an individual has. According to Dr. Lieberman, "Some psychologists accept insurance and use a sliding charge scale, so that the rate of the mental evaluation adjusts according to your earnings." In addition, community mental health centers frequently offer services at a reduced rate.
It's essential to know how much a psychiatric evaluation will cost before making a visit for one. In addition to figuring out how much the examination will cost, it's essential to comprehend what to anticipate throughout the assessment.
Throughout a psychiatric assessment manchester examination, the psychiatrist will ask the person being examined concerns about their thoughts, sensations and behavior. The psychiatrist will also look at the person's look and disposition to assess their non-verbal hints and psychological guideline. They will inquire about the patient's family history, as some mental health conditions are passed down through genes.
The Initial Consultation
When you attend the preliminary assessment, a psychiatrist will consult with you and be familiar with more about you. This will include taking a detailed medical and psychiatric history. They might likewise ask about your family, relationships, and cultural background in order to get a full understanding of your signs. This session can last from 30-90 minutes and it is necessary to be sincere and open with your psychiatrist in order for them to make an accurate diagnosis.
It is helpful to prepare for this appointment before you get here. Make a note of a list of your signs and any other information you desire to go over. This will assist you keep your thoughts organized and prevent the possibility of forgetting something during the consultation. Additionally, it can be a great concept to bring a friend or family member to the appointment for assistance. They can drive you to and from the visit, provide psychological assistance, and offer distractions if you are nervous.
During this appointment, your psychiatrist will likely supply you with a diagnosis and create a treatment strategy for you to follow. This might include medication, therapy, way of life modifications, or a combination of these approaches. The doctor will also discuss how these treatments will collaborate and will talk about any other concerns you might have.
The frequency of your psychiatric assessments will depend upon the condition you are being treated for and how well your medications are working. For instance, if you are being dealt with for depression, your psychiatrist will need to monitor how the medications are working for you and adjust them as needed. This will usually just require to happen every few months.
Your insurance protection will play a substantial role in the cost of your psychiatric examinations. If you are seeing a psychiatrist who is in-network, this will be cheaper than an out-of-network medical professional. Furthermore, some insurance providers will repay a part of the expenses for appointments with in-network psychiatrists.
You should always inspect your insurance coverage before making a consultation. The costs of a psychiatric assessment can include up quickly, especially without appropriate coverage. The Initial Treatment Session
When a psychiatrist has a clear understanding of what is occurring, they can recommend a treatment strategy. This may consist of medication, psychiatric therapy, lifestyle modifications, or a combination of these techniques. In the majority of cases, clients will need to come in for follow-up visits. These check outs will assist figure out if medications are working or not, and how well the therapy is advancing.
During the treatment sessions, the psychiatrist will take a look at the patient's mental health, observe non-verbal cues, and search for indications of psychological guideline. They will likewise review the patient's medical history, including past psychiatric treatments and medications. In addition, they might ask for family history, as particular conditions are passed down through genes. Throughout this time, the psychiatrist can likewise conduct lab work or blood tests to inspect for possible physical reasons for the symptoms.
While a psychiatric assessment is not the only way to detect a mental disease, it is one of the most typical and most efficient techniques. While not everybody displays signs of a mental disease, an examination can provide important information for anyone worried about their psychological wellness or habits.
Just like any health care see, the cost of a psychiatric evaluation can vary depending on insurance protection and the company's charges. In basic, a psychiatrist will charge between $80 to $250 per session without insurance coverage. Nevertheless, there are ways to reduce the costs of an examination.
One alternative is to seek out a psychiatrist who operates at a center, university, or school. These providers can provide a sliding scale charge based upon earnings, which is an affordable service for those on tight budget plans.
Another solution is to discover a neighborhood mental health center that provides psychiatric services for a low charge or free of charge. These facilities aim to make mental healthcare accessible for everyone, and their services are typically lower than personal practices.
In addition to these resources, lots of individuals likewise turn to good friends or member of the family for help. In some cases, these individuals serve as advocates and can negotiate a better deal for the individual getting a psychiatric assessment treatment.
The Follow-Up Treatment Session
When your psychiatrist has a firm grasp on your condition, they will work with you to come up with an appropriate treatment strategy. This might include a combination of psychotherapy and medications. Depending upon your insurance coverage, your follow-up treatment sessions may cost less or more than the initial consultation. You will likewise require to pay for any medications that are recommended. These costs will differ, however can accumulate quickly.
Psychiatric evaluations and treatments are pricey, however they are crucial to your health. They can help you get the care you need to feel better and live a happier, much healthier life.
The cost of a psychiatric evaluation will depend upon several elements, including the medical professional's costs and your insurance coverage. Psychiatrists can charge various rates due to their place, years of experience, specialized know-how, and demand. In addition, some doctors might have additional treatment costs, like bloodwork and psychological screening, that will add to the total cost.
A psychiatric evaluation will usually happen at a clinic or psychological university hospital. In a lot of cases, the doctor will perform a clinical interview to collect details about your signs and habits. The psychologist might ask about your family history, work life, and relationships. They may also use mental tests to get insight into your psychological state. Other tools they can utilize include self-report surveys, psychiatric assessment Cost cognitive evaluations, and behavioral observation.
Health insurance coverage will cover a large part of the psychiatric assessment, however there are some exceptions. For example, some insurance coverage plans require a recommendation from your main care supplier to approve the check out. Others will only cover in-network providers.
